6 changes: 6 additions & 0 deletions tests/ui/macros/println-percent-prefix-num-issue-125002.rs
Original file line number Diff line number Diff line change
@@ -0,0 +1,6 @@
fn main() {
println!("%100000", 1);
//~^ ERROR argument never used
println!("% 65536", 1);
//~^ ERROR argument never used
}
28 changes: 28 additions & 0 deletions tests/ui/macros/println-percent-prefix-num-issue-125002.stderr
Original file line number Diff line number Diff line change
@@ -0,0 +1,28 @@
error: argument never used
--> $DIR/println-percent-prefix-num-issue-125002.rs:2:25
|
LL | println!("%100000", 1);
| ^ argument never used
|
note: format specifiers use curly braces, and the conversion specifier `1` is unknown or unsupported
--> $DIR/println-percent-prefix-num-issue-125002.rs:2:15
|
LL | println!("%100000", 1);
| ^^
= note: printf formatting is not supported; see the documentation for `std::fmt`

error: argument never used
--> $DIR/println-percent-prefix-num-issue-125002.rs:4:29
|
LL | println!("% 65536", 1);
| ^ argument never used
|
note: format specifiers use curly braces, and the conversion specifier ` ` is unknown or unsupported
--> $DIR/println-percent-prefix-num-issue-125002.rs:4:15
|
LL | println!("% 65536", 1);
| ^^
= note: printf formatting is not supported; see the documentation for `std::fmt`

error: aborting due to 2 previous errors
